Michael Ferrier

Biography

Michael Ferrier was born in 1967 in Strasbourg. His grandmother was Indian and his grandfather Mauritian. He grew up in Africa and the Indian Ocean area. He studied at the École normale supérieure de Fontenay-aux-Roses, getting a doctorate in literature.He is currently Professor at Chuo University, Tokyo. He has written novels, stories and essays, set in various parts of the world. He has written extensively on the Fukushima disaster. Three of his books have been translated into English.
